The distribution of open source software is controlled by special, free licenses, most of which require that modifications be made available to the community. They can fix bugs, improve functions, or adapt the software to suit their own needs. The software distributor may attach a purchase price to it. Free, secure and fast distributed computing software downloads from the largest open source applications and software directory. Software that fits the free software definition may be more appropriately called free software. Distributed tracing systems enable users to track a request through a software system that is distributed across multiple applications, services, and databases as well as intermediaries like proxies. The definition was taken from the exact text of the debian free software guidelines, written and adapted primarily by bruce perens with input from the debian developers on a private debian mailing list. The difference between free and opensource software. Free open source linux distributed computing software. Easily deploy lightweight compute logic using developerfriendly apis without needing to run your own stream processing engine.
Aug 05, 2014 among thousands of open source software projects these 10 open source softwares listed below are the most important and valuable. Freedcs is an open source distributed control system that is currently in the design phase. Projectcommunity open source is developed and managed by a distributed community of developers who cooperatively improve and support the source code without remuneration. Apr 21, 2020 moosefs is a petabyte open source network distributed file system. Because the software s license encourages modification and customization, it is nearly impossible to support. Internetspeed development uses geographically distributed teams to work around the clock. There may be no time, place, or manner limitations on distribution in an open source licensebut this does not mean that there may be no conditions on distribution at all. This is the world of open source software, where code is written and distributed freely. Nov 20, 2019 open source software oss is any computer software thats distributed with its source code available for modification. They can fix bugs, improve functions, or adapt the software. The open source definition annotated open source initiative.
Distributors of open source software have the right to make their own choices about their own. Anyone can spin up a new openchain instance within seconds. Jami is a gnu project backed by the free software foundation and distributed under a gplv3 license. This is why red hat software, founded in 1994, created the official red hat linux and is able to sell this normally. Free, secure and fast linux distributed computing software downloads from the largest open source applications and software directory. Free open source windows distributed computing software. Although these are all aspects of the open source phenomenon, there is actually a more precise definition. Opensource software development is a production model that exploits the distributed intelligence of participants in internet communities. For more information about the philosophical background for opensource software, see free software movement and open source initiative. This is a list of free and open source software packages, computer software licensed under free software licenses and open source licenses.
Compare the best free open source windows distributed computing software at sourceforge. Open source distributed computingcloud computing frameworks. Hadoop is a popular open source distributed storage platform for processing data. Open source software is made by many people, and distributed under licenses that comply with the open source definition. Hpe and industry partners simplify 5g rollout with open. The administrator of an openchain instance defines the rules of the ledger. Millions of downloads and a full range of robust, open source integration software tools have made talend the open source leader in cloud and big data integration. Embed existing java code libraries, create your own components or leverage community components and code to extend your project. Eventually, vita nuova released the source under the gpl license and the inferno operating system is now a freelibre open source software project. Top 10 best open source softwares that rocks world wide web. The license must explicitly permit distribution of software built from modified source code. Mar 31, 2020 the open source release of the open distributed infrastructure management initiative to the linux foundation is also targeted to take place in q2 cy 2020 and will be accessible via. For example, the license must not insist that all other programs distributed on the same medium must be open source software. It is easy to deploy and maintain, highly reliable, fault tolerant, highly performing, easily scalable and posix compliant.
Top 5 best version control software source code management. This allows for a deeper understanding of what is happening within the software system. It is available in source code form without charge or at cost 2. Over recent years though, and especially for new projects, open source databases have steadily grown in maturity and importance. For examples of software free in the monetary sense, see list of freeware. Its different from a traditional database in that time is the primary axis of concern, and the analytics and visualization of massive data sets is a top priority. They ported the software to new hardware and focused on distributed applications.
These are rare software product that has no alternatives and must require. In this article, ill discuss some of the principles and tools that make this approach possible. What are good open source distributed systems projects to get. Mar 31, 2020 hpe announced its working with intel and the linux foundation on a new open source software project for the rollout of 5g across multiple sites. Free, secure and fast distributed computing software downloads from the. The license may restrict sourcecode from being distributed in modified form only if the license allows the distribution of patch files with the source code for the purpose of modifying the program at build time. Distributed tracing systems enable users to track a request through a software system that is distributed across multiple applications, services.
List of best open source blockchain platforms and their. When you buy software like microsoft office, you typically only get the binary code, which makes it hard to understand or modify the software. Free open source distributed computing software sourceforge. Software released into the public domain does not have this requirement. The linux kernel is a prominent example of free and open source software. Store streams of data safely in a distributed, replicated, faulttolerant cluster. Open source software oss is software distributed under a license that meets certain criteria. Distributed storage infrastructure developed to solve the problem of backing up and sharing petabytes of scientific results using a distributed model of volunteer managed hosts. The best open source software for cloud computing infoworld s 2018 best of open source software award winners in cloud computing by jonathan freeman, victor r. Openchain is an open source distributed ledger technology.
Proprietary software pros and cons pros and cons of opensource software there are two types of open software. Open source advocates wanted to focus on the practical benefits of using open source software that would appeal more to businesses, rather than ethics and morals. Or in layman terms, the source code is not shared with the public for anyone to look at or change. Open source software is a radical model oriented technology which enables the organization to fasten their development to initially reduce the cost entirely, and in return, it increases the innovation to get the goal of efficiency. The provider offers a turnkey solution that includes compute orchestration, network as a service, user and account management, resource accounting, and a full and open.
How opensource software became the new industry standard. Open source licenses may condition the distribution of derivative works on reciprocity of licensing, an important device. Radondb is an open source, cloudnative mysql database for unlimited scalability and performance. It will allow to control any process, machine or equipment reading values from instruments through industry standards 420ma, digital io, etc and perform a control strategy with that information to maintain the final product into the specification. The platform supports windows, linux, and macos operating systems. This article is about software free to be modified and distributed. Traditionally, databases have been proprietary tools provided by oracle, ibm, microsoft, and a number of other smaller vendors. Apr 06, 2020 closed source software can be defined as proprietary software distributed under a licensing agreement to authorized users with private modification, copying, and republishing restrictions. It is horizontally scalable, faulttolerant, wicked. Five outstanding linux server distributions, all of which are free, open source, and ready to take your small or midsized business to the next level.
Oct 30, 2017 an important distinction of both free and open source software is that works based on free or open source source code must also be distributed with a foss license. The open source definition is a document published by the open source initiative, to determine whether a software license can be labeled with the opensource certification mark. This model is efficient because of two related reasons. Provides free open source software and support to enable a sustained future for the uk e. Aug 20, 2019 cloudstack is open source software designed to deploy and manage large networks of virtual machines, as a scalable infrastructure as a service iaas cloud computing platform. Arches is distributed under the gnu affero general public license. Moosefs spreads data over a number of commodity servers, which are visible to the user as one resource. This is a list of free and opensource software packages, computer software licensed under free software licenses and opensource licenses. A common concern for endusers who wish to use open source software is the lack of a warranty and technical support. Contribute to elasticelasticsearch development by creating an account on github.
Asynchronous decisionmaking is a strategy that enables geographically and culturally distributed software teams to make decisions more efficiently. Free, secure and fast windows distributed computing software downloads from the largest open source applications and software directory. It is an apache foundation project that is compatible with apache spark, hive, and yam. Generally, open source software is software that can be freely accessed, used, changed, and shared in modified or unmodified form by anyone. Opensource software oss is any computer software thats distributed with its source code available for modification. That means it usually includes a license for programmers to change the software in any way they choose. It is suited for organizations wishing to issue and manage digital assets in a robust, secure and scalable way. It is posix compliant and acts just like unixlike e. The timescale is a type of whats called a time series database. This method, mostly adopted by large closedsource firms. Several physical commodity servers are visible to the user as one virtual disk.
So how did a business model that essentially revolves around. The license must not place restrictions on other software that is distributed along with the licensed software. Git is easy to learn and has a tiny footprint with lightning fast performance. Radondb is a cloudnative database based on mysql,and architected in fully distributed cluster that enable unlimited scalability scaleout, capacity and performance. February 14, 2018 certain of caavos services include thirdparty code licensed to caavo for use and redistribution under opensource licenses. Frequently answered questions open source initiative. Openchain blockchain technology for the enterprise. The open source release of the open distributed infrastructure management initiative to the linux foundation is also targeted to take place in the second quarter and will be accessible via. One of the best open source databases for that is timescale. The top 231 distributed systems open source projects. Below is a list of disclosures and disclaimers in connection with caavos incorporation of certain opensource licensed software into its services. Sep 06, 2019 while not widely distributed in on its own, chromium os forms the basis of the chrome os that runs on chromebooks, which are particularly popular in the education market. For example, linux is available at no cost as fedora, centos, gentoo, etc.
Jami is completely peertopeer and doesnt require a server for relaying data between users. Compare the best free open source distributed computing software at sourceforge. Free and open source simply means the software is free to distribute, modify, study, and use, subject to the softwares licensing. Aug 22, 2018 open source code refers to any program whose source code is made available for use or modification as users or other developers see fit. Kafka is used for building realtime data pipelines and streaming apps.
Open source software programmers can actually charge money. Open source may be modified and redistributed without additional. List of free and opensource software packages wikipedia. Apache pulsar is an open source distributed pubsub messaging system originally created at yahoo and now part of the apache software foundation. Read and write streams of data like a messaging system. Categories software architecture distributed systems. Contribute to theanalystawesomedistributedsystems development by creating. Sep 15, 2017 the open source software movement was created to focus on more pragmatic reasons for choosing this type of software. Hpe, intel and linux foundation team up for open source. Whats the difference between a fork and a distribution.
Who decides what distribution means in open source licenses. Distributed file system best open source petabyte storage. Git is a free and open source distributed version control system designed to handle everything from small to very large projects with speed and efficiency. What is open source software, and why does it matter. Compare the best free open source linux distributed computing software at sourceforge. Write scalable stream processing applications that react to events in realtime. Source software development and distributed innovation. Open source database software overview what is open source database software.
Hpe unveils open source software to reduce 5g complexity. To the knowledge of the company, no material product of the company group is distributed with any software that is licensed to the company group pursuant to an open source, public source, freeware or other third party license agreement in a manner that, in each case, requires the company group to disclose or license any material proprietary source code that embodies. I was wondering if anyone knows of any good open source distributed computing projects. The best open source software for cloud computing infoworld. We use state of the art endtoend encryption with perfect forward secrecy for all communications and comply with the x.
508 640 434 493 273 1456 1201 1101 49 724 641 628 1362 800 1496 516 934 1547 1126 1186 276 58 1593 9 996 990 658 1591 476 1181 805 1428 863 303 238 1187 33 671 1137 1383 1223